This prospect is only known approximately and it may be in the West Chichagof-Yakobi Wilderness.
Location: The location of this occurrence is only known approximately to be at an elevation of about 950 feet, midway between lakes 43 and 423, northeast of Ford Arm. For this record, the site is plotted 0.5 mile northeast of the center of sec. 25, T. 49 S., R. 59 E. It is location P-87 of Bittenbender and others (1999) and MAS no. 0021140128 (U.S. Bureau of Land Management, 2002).
Geology: Johnson and Karl (1985) map the rocks in the area of this occurrence as Cretaceous(?) phyllite and Cretaceous greenstone. The rocks are cut by steeply-dipping, mainly northwest-striking faults, including the regional-scale Border Ranges Fault whose trace is about 0.5 mile northeast of the occurrence. Bittenbender and others (1999), citing Kimball (1982), describe the occurrence as a disseminated sulfide deposit in chlorite schist, hornfels, chert, and greenstone. Samples contained up to 300 parts per million (ppm) copper and 0.5 ppm silver.
Workings: Only surface sampling.

Commodities (Major) - Ag, Cu
Development Status: None
Deposit Model: Disseminated sulfide deposit.
